Heating system Breakdowns-- Exactly What to Anticipate
As they claim, expertise is half the fight. Heater breakdowns or malfunctions are not always loudly announced or a grand dramatic scene, but it is always clear that something is wrong. When your heater remains in problem, opportunities are just one of 2 points are occurring.

Situation 1: Unexpected Warm Loss-- This is the classic interpretation of a furnace breakdown; the heater shuts down all of a sudden as well as permanently. Often, this happens in the coldest part of the evening, so your household will awake to a frozen home and also no warmth.

Possible Causes: This could be brought on by a huge range of issues such as loss of power, malfunctioning pilot burner, malfunctioning circuitry; the listing goes on. As a result of the big selection of feasible reasons, it is extremely important to leave these complications to the educated, professional service technicians.

Situation 2: Short Biking-- This furnace concern is less popular http://dorrianheating.com/ however no much less severe of a complication. Brief cycling is when your heater clicks on as well as off simply put ruptureds instead of continual durations. With such short operating times, the residence never effectively warms as well as the start-stop nature of procedure adds a great deal of damage to your system.

Feasible Reasons: An unclean filter is likely the source of this problem. The obstructed filter restricts the air flow and also creates a backup of air and also warmth. The furnace's interior temperature level reaches too expensive of a degree and also the safety turned off button powers the device down. Then, since the thermostat still has to bring the house to a certain temperature, it powers the furnace back up as well as the cycle repeats.

Heating System Troubleshooting Tips
Examine the Power Switch on a Gas Heater: Head over to your circuit breaker and ensure the circuit is switched on for your heater. If it gets on, aim to transform the circuit off and then on again. This could reboot the system.



Check the Thermostat: You would certainly be astonished just how usually heater malfunctions really ended up being a thermostat issue. Inspect the setups on your thermostat. Is it readied to warm? Is the temperature established properly? Is the fan readied to vehicle?

Inspect the Furnace Filter: Heater filters must be altered every month throughout both the cooling and heating season. A clogged heater will protect against air flow to your furnace creating a full system closed down. Eliminate the filter and if dirty, change as well as try to trigger the furnace once more.

NOTE: Do not attempt to run your furnace without a filter! The dirt in the air will swiftly coat the interior parts of the heating system causing a a lot more extreme as well as far more expensive malfunction.

Low Air Flow: Examine the air movement coming from your vents. If the atmospheric pressure is really low, head outside to the outside air vent. There could be leaves, snow, or ice blocking the air duct causing the heating system to underperform. Nonetheless, be sure to turn the power off to the heating system prior to trying this.
